Slow-cooked goat with wild mountain greens and olive oil. A rustic Cretan specialty tied to village cooking and the island's pastoral tradition.
Barley rusks topped with tomato, mizithra or feta, olive oil, and oregano. A classic Cretan meze showcasing local dairy and produce.
Tiny hand-cut pasta cooked in rich meat broth, often with goat or lamb. Traditional at weddings and festive family gatherings in Crete.

Moderate for a Greek island. Summer rooms and car hire rise fast, but tavern meals, coffee, and buses stay reasonable versus Santorini or Mykonos.
Service is usually included. Round up or leave 5-10% at restaurants for good service, round up taxi fares, and leave small change at cafes.
